How they compare

Cuba currently reports 229 t against 50 t in Asia, a difference of 179 t.

That makes Cuba's figure about 4.6 times Asia's.

The two have swapped places 2 times across 6 shared years of data; in 1996 it was Cuba ahead.

Asia ranks 3rd and Cuba ranks 4th of 4 groups.

Asia has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Asia Cuba Difference Ahead
1990s 3,400 t 1,660 t 1,740 t Asia
2000s 3,362 t 335.33 t 3,026 t Asia

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
